Output 83d07aaad549d539a44b5ca8f4d1bfd60f3aeea229fa76c8cb602d89d9319ad0:2

value
26695589
script pubkey
OP_0 OP_PUSHBYTES_20 75d5d31f67d2fc4ec17a2e01ae5e300266d0ab89
address
bc1qwh2ax8m86t7yast69cq6uh3sqfndp2ufdnlf38
transaction
83d07aaad549d539a44b5ca8f4d1bfd60f3aeea229fa76c8cb602d89d9319ad0
spent
true